Glorious Death was formed in 2004
by guitarist Mike McKeown in St. Louis, Missouri. The bands first
demo, "Die a Glorious Death" was released in October 2004,
with only two tracks. The demo had strong black metal influences, with
an unusual focus on the bass guitar. The band switched to a more
standard metal sound for their first full length release,
"Devolution," which has since been discontinued.
Returning in 2005 for "The
Principles of Evil" EP, Glorious Death, at this point entirely
the work of Mike McKeown, showed the strongest black metal influences
yet, but was rushed in recording and production.
On September 30th, 2006, Glorious
Death released the "Evolution" EP, correcting the
mistakes of the last EP and showing a stronger focus on symphonic
elements and overall composition, rather than being a guitar focused
project. The album features a larger focus on production and an overall theme to the album.
In August, 2007 the band released
"The Dawn of Darkness," a full-length album of 11 tracks. This

As of late 2007, Ryan Dowell and Jesse McCoy joined the band, on viola and guitar, respectively. Tyler has been added on live
keyboards until the band finds a suitable full-time replacement. In 2008, Jaimie Wood joined as the band's celloist, completing the current
line-up. A few months later Jessie quit, and Ryne Jones came in to cover vocals, with the band deciding not to add a second
guitarist, at least for now. In spring of 2008, Glorious Death will begin recording for its second full-length album, "Utopia en Ruinas" due out late the same year.
This will be the first album not written and recorded exclusivley by Mike McKeown, but instead will feature the 5-piece current lineup and the new
keyboardist.
